4. Are there direct trains from London Bridge to Earlswood (Surrey)?
Yes, there are direct trains from London Bridge to Earlswood (Surrey). You can check to find the live train timetable, stops, and more details. No transfers are needed, allowing you to reach your destination smoothly and effortlessly.
5. What are the main train operating companies from London Bridge to Earlswood (Surrey)?
From London Bridge to Earlswood (Surrey), the main train operator is Thameslink. TrainPal also compares live schedules and services from other train companies. Our goal is to help you book cheap train tickets for a cost-saving and relaxed journey.
6. How far in advance can I book UK train tickets?
In the UK, train tickets can typically be booked up to 12 weeks in advance. This allows you to secure the best fares and ensure availability, especially during peak travel times. For some routes, advance tickets may be released even earlier, so it's always a good idea to check with TrainPal.

1. Are there discounts for students or seniors on UK train tickets?
Yes. Our
Railcards offer discounts on UK train tickets. Students can use the
16-17 Saver or
16-25 Railcard for up to 1/3 off most fares. Seniors aged 60 and over can use the
Senior Railcard for 1/3 off. Railcards can be purchased online with a choice of one-year or three-year validity. The more you travel, the more you save.
2. Can UK train tickets be refunded or changed?
In the UK, the refund and exchange policies for train tickets vary depending on the type of ticket purchased.
Advance Tickets are usually non-refundable but can sometimes be exchanged for a fee.
Anytime Train Tickets and
Off-Peak train tickets offer more generous refund and exchange options. Always check the terms and conditions of your ticket or visit
UK train ticket types for specific details.
